Verizon bound Samsung "Jasper" spotted...


An image has surface of a Samsung device with the product number SCH-i200 however should be known by it's codename "Jasper". This device has been leaked many times before but this is the first time it has been leaked with images included.

This image confirms a few things. The device will run Android 4.0 out of the box with Samsung's TouchWiz UI over the top, it will have support for Verizon's LTE band and the rear-facing camera of which the resolution has not been leaked won't have a flash. Other than that, the device is said to run a dual-core Qualcomm processor (MSM8960) clocked at 1.5GHz and will have a WVGA (480x800) display.

Motorola Atrix HD for AT&T official...


The Motorola codenamed smartphone "Dinara" has now officially been revealed as the AT&T bound Motorola Atrix HD, the smartphone packs a 4.5-inch 720p display, dual-core processor and LTE compatibility. The display being one of the highest resolution on the market currently, no word has been said as to whether the Atrix HD will be made available in the UK but it is highly unlikely.

The exact specs include a 4.5-inch 720p display powered by a dual-core processor clocked at 1.5GHz with 1GB of RAM. Cameras include a 8-megapixel rear-facing camera and a 1.3-megapixel front-facing camera for video calling. There is 8GB of internal storage with the added benefit of expansion by MicroSD card up 32GB. The Atrix HD takes advantage of Android 4.0 with on-screen soft keys instead of capacitive/physical buttons.

Sony GX and SX heading for Japan...

Sony has announced two new smartphones -both LTE enabled, for Japan. Out of the two, the Xperia GX stands out the most combining the specs of the Xperia Ion but boasting a whopping 13MP camera. The SX however is the lightweight of the two claiming to be the lightest LTE compatible handset at 95g.

Xperia GX
The Xperia GX was formerly known as the LT29i Hayabusa that has been wildly leaked over the past few weeks, It comes with a 4.6-inch HD Reality Display along with the Mobile BRAVIA engine. The display has a resolution of 720x1280 giving a pixel density of 319PPI. A 1.5GHz dual-core Snapdragon S4 processor, has a 13MP snapper on the back with Exmor R camera sensor that should enhance low-light performance and a 1.3MP front facing camera for video calls. The phone comes with 16GB of internal storage, a 1700mAh battery and Android 4.0 out of the box.
Xperia SX



The Xperia SX comes with a 3.7-inch qHD display with a resolution of 540x960 giving a pixel density of 298PPI, the display is enhanced using Sony's Mobile BRAVIA engine, 1.5GHz dual-core Snapdragon S4 processor with 1GB RAM, a 8MP camera on the back with Exmor R camera sensor, a front facing 1.3MP camera for video calls. Theres 8GBs of internal storage, a 1500mAh battery and Android 4.0 out of the box.
